Vienna Acoustics Oratorio Center Channels

Vienna Acoustics Oratorio Center Channels 

DESCRIPTION

  • Frequency Response: 33Hz-25kHz
  • Impedance: 4 ohms, nominal
  • Sensitivity: 90dB 1W/1m, 2.83V
  • Power Handling: 50-300W, without clipping
  • Dimensions: 29-1/2 x 9.5 x 15 inches

Used as center channel and as surround channels with VA Mahlers as fronts. Shares same strengths as Mahlers with extended bass response, smooth and open mids and sweet highs. Uses of dual 9" woofers enhances low end performance. Reproduces voices with great detail and smoothness. Does have contour switches which allows them to match speakers other than VA for front channels. Very solidly built and quite heavy for center channel. I've used other center channels including Revel Voice, Legacy Marquis and Magnepan CC center. The Revel Voice was the best fo those three past centers but the VA Oratorio provides comparable or better performance at a lower cost. Not quite as forward sounding as the Revel Voice in the midrange and has better low frequency extension.
